// Fixture: turnstile_counts_sample.json
//
// Fake gate data for the Larkfield Arena turnstile counter tests.
// Covers the weird cases: double-spins, reversed entries, and the
// midnight rollover that bit us last season. Don't regenerate this
// by hand — run make fixtures instead.
//
// The fixture loader hits the counts API, so it expects the sandbox
// bearer token below.

session JWT of yawep-yawep = eyJhbGciOiJIUzI1NiIsInR5cCI6IkpXVCJ9.eyJzdWIiOiI3pWF3_In0.aXYsHiog

# Bloom filter config for the Pebblecache KV tier.
# Quick note for the eng sync: we front every GET with a bloom
# filter now, so cold misses skip the disk hop entirely. False
# positive rate is tuned to ~1%. Sizing lives in filter_bits below.
# The filter warms itself on boot from the store reachable at the connection string below.

replica DSN, kajep-yahag: mssql://praok_svc:iF@db-8d68.plorvaio.local:5432/eliion

Subject: Profile store sharding — cutover plan

Team, this week we split the Mirebrook user-profile store into eight shards keyed by account region. For new folks: writes now route through the Cassavel proxy, which owns the shard map; never connect a worker directly to a shard. Reads stay dual-path until Friday while we validate row counts. Rollback is a proxy config flip, nothing destructive. Please verify your local configs against the canary build, whose trace token appears just below.

build token for kagaf-hahof: htk14_9d3d4d26d7d8de

Internal Memo — Branch Managers

You've probably heard rumblings: Dravell & Sons sent over a term sheet for the co-distribution deal. Broad strokes look decent — shared warehousing, their trucks on our southern routes, a three-year initial term. Exclusivity language is the sticking point; they want all of Kestrel Valley, and we're pushing back. Don't discuss this with Dravell reps who drop by your branches; route everything through Helga's office. For context on why we're even entertaining this, see the note below.

confidential, kagep-kahof: Druokax Systems plans to lower the Ulaath list price by 53 percent in March.